WRAL-TV’s Tower came to life for the holidays with the lighting on December 3rd..

A crowd gathered outside the WRAL-TV Studios on Western Blvd on the evening of Monday, December 3, 2007, even though bitter winds whipped.   The group came to see an annual Triangle tradition, the lighting of WRAL’s 300-foot television tower for the holidays.  Viewers at home saw the festivities in the warmth of their dens on the half-hour “Celebrate the Season” special at 7:30pm.

WRAL-TV Anchors Debra Morgan, Gerald Owens & David Crabtree hosted the musical event along with WRAL-TV Chief Meteorologist Greg Fishel.  The Raleigh Jazz Quartet, Tar Heel Voices and Evette Anderson provided a musical backdrop for the evening which culminated with a countdown and the lighting of the tower.

The 2,805 colored lights and stars will brighten the night sky through the holidays until New Years.  Happy Holidays from WRAL-TV and Capitol Broadcasting!
